3 много воды утекло
много (немало) воды утекло (ушло) < с тех пор>a lot of (much) water has flown (run) < under the bridges> since then (since that time); much time has elapsed since then; cf. there has been many a peck of salt eaten since that timeМного воды утекло с тех пор, много воспоминаний о былом потеряли для меня значение и стали смутными мечтами... (Л. Толстой, Детство) — Much time has elapsed since then, many remembrances of the past have lost their significance, becoming but confused dreams.
- Господи, она уже взрослая! - сказал он... - Что делает время! - Да, пять лет! - вздохнула Таня. - Много воды утекло с тех пор. (А. Чехов, Чёрный монах) — 'Good heavens! she is grown up,' he said... 'What time does!' 'Yes, five years!' sighed Tanya. 'Much water has flowed since then.'
Ни он, ни она не искали этой встречи и, может быть, даже не вспоминали друг друга - слишком уж много воды утекло с тех пор. (Б. Полевой, Повесть о настоящем человеке) — Neither had sought that meeting, and they had probably even forgotten each other - so much water had flown under the bridge since their parting.
